<p>I would do it this way, its not that important:</p>
<p>deactivate SoftRAID license on your 2016</p>
<p>Migrate to new computer. (I would not have the drives connected no need)</p>
<p>Do these steps:</p>
<p>https://www.softraid.com/docs/softraid-quick-start-guide/installation-macos/additional-steps-for-apple-silicon-macs/</p>
<p>Then run SoftRAID on the MacBook Pro, if you did not already and install the driver, and activate your license. Connect your drives.</p>
<p>that should take care of your migration.</p>]]></content:encoded>

                        <content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>First thing you must do is this:</p>
<p>https://support.apple.com/en-lk/guide/mac-help/mchl768f7291/mac<br />Select reduced security and enable this:<br />Select the “Allow user management of kernel extensions from identified developers” checkbox to allow installation of software that uses legacy kernel extensions.</p>
<p>then you can install the SoftRAID driver and "Allow" OWC as an identified developer.</p>
<p>Note: if this is a RAID 5 volume, a % of users, I would guess 2-5%, get kernel panics when their enclosure is connected. There are some workarounds available.</p>
<p>Other than that, it should be easy to migrate.</p>]]></content:encoded>
